Pay-Per-View
 35
Tips
T
IPS
You can prevent others from purchasing Pay-Per-View programs by using locks (see 
page 45).
Keep an active phone line connected to your receiver so you can order Pay-Per-View 
programs with your remote control.
Q
UESTIONS
How can I order an event for all my receivers? 
Order on each receiver, one at a time with the remote control. Make sure an active 
phone line is connected to each receiver.
Order the event over the phone 1-877-DISH-PPV (347-4778). Charges may 
apply.
Order the event online at www.dishnetwork.com/ppv. 
Order the event over the phone at 1-800-333-DISH. Charges may apply.
I ordered a Pay-Per-View but can only see it on one receiver. Some Pay-Per-View 
programs are restricted to one receiver per account.
Will I be charged more than once for ordering the same Pay-Per-View on two or 
more receivers?
 If you’re using the remote control, you won’t be charged more than 
once as long as it is the same exact event (for example, at the same time or All Day 
events).
Why doesn’t my Program Guide show any Pay-Per-View channels? You may be 
using a Favorites List that doesn’t include Pay-Per-View channels. Press GUIDE to 
open the Program Guide and then press GUIDE again until you see All Chan in the 
upper left corner of the Program Guide. See Chapter 5 - Favorites Lists on page 37 for 
more information on using Favorites Lists. You may have Pay-Per-View channels 
locked and hidden. See Chapter 6 - Parental Controls on page 41.
Why are some Pay-Per-View programs blacked out? Sporting events and other 
programs are sometimes blacked out because of local restrictions.
Why did my all-day Pay-Per-View program shut off while I was watching it? The 
all-day events run from 3 AM to 3 AM (Mountain Time).
